A careful hand wash is safer for your car's paint than an automatic brush wash. Automatic washes are fast and convenient, but their brushes and reused water can drag grit across the surface and leave fine swirl marks that dull the finish over time. A proper hand wash, using safe technique, cleans more thoroughly and protects the paint. That said, a careless hand wash can scratch too, so how it is done is what really matters.
The problem with automatic washes
Automatic car washes are quick and cheap, but the rotating brushes contact every car that came before yours, and the grit they carry gets dragged across your paint. Over many washes this builds up the fine spider-web scratches known as swirl marks, most visible under sunlight. Touchless washes avoid the brushes but rely on stronger chemicals and high pressure, and often leave the car less clean.
Why hand washing is gentler
A proper hand wash lets dirt be lifted and rinsed safely rather than scrubbed in. Using the two-bucket method, a soft mitt, and plenty of lubrication, grit is carried away from the paint instead of ground into it. It also reaches the areas a machine cannot, the door shuts, badges, lower panels and trim, for a genuinely cleaner result.
But technique matters
Hand washing is only safer if it is done well. A sponge dropped on the ground and put back on the car, a single bucket of dirty water, or wiping a dry, dusty car will all add scratches. The safe approach is to rinse off loose grit first, use clean water and a soft mitt, work top to bottom, and dry with a clean microfibre.
The best of both worlds
For everyday convenience, a touchless wash is gentler than a brush wash if you are short on time. But for protecting your paint and getting a thorough clean, a careful hand wash, or a professional valet that includes a safe hand wash, is the better choice. Many owners use a quick wash for upkeep and a proper valet periodically.
